The core of Final Vision

Character identity engine

Identity Locked Reference-Anchored Style-Proof

AI image tools reinvent your character's face in every frame. Final Vision doesn't. Author a character once and every storyboard frame, casting panel, and shot is generated against the same locked reference assets.

Final Vision character page for Deekan: locked master profile reference with full-body and head turnaround sheets from every angle

Master Profiles

A cinematic master portrait plus a structured bio for every character — the single source of truth the rest of the pipeline reads from.

How the lock works →

Identity Reference Sheets

Turnarounds and face close-ups composed into deterministic reference sheets (CRS) that anchor AI generation to the same person every time.

Why references beat prompts →

Props & Wardrobe

Attach named props and wardrobe references per character so signature items stay consistent from storyboard to shot list.

Straight into Unreal Engine

Shot List Import Real Lenses MetaHuman Posing Round-Trip Capture

Your boards don't stop at a PDF. The Final Vision plugin pulls your whole shot list into Unreal — cameras, lenses, blocking and all — so the plan you made becomes a scene you can actually walk around in.

The Final Vision plugin running inside Unreal Engine: an imported 93-shot list, scouting and staging panels, a storyboard frame placed in the 3D scene as a reference plane, MetaHuman pose matching, and the shot built into Sequencer

Your shot list, imported

Every shot arrives with its size, lens and movement. Cameras spawn with the focal length and stop you specified — not a generic 16:9 default.

The board, in the scene

Your storyboard frame is placed into 3D space as a reference plane, so you can line the camera up against the image you already approved.

Characters that match the board

Pose matching reads each shot and poses your MetaHumans to the frame, then builds the whole thing into Sequencer — ready to capture back.

Technology

Built on our own
character identity engine.

The Character Reference System gives generative models a deterministic, versioned definition of who your characters are — portable reference assets composed from turnarounds and face close-ups, attached to every generation in a strict authority order: identity first, style second, staging third.

How does the character identity lock actually work? +

Each character gets deterministic reference assets — a master profile, casting panels, and a high-density identity sheet with turnarounds and face close-ups. When you generate a storyboard frame, those references are attached to the generation with a strict authority order: identity first, style second, staging third. Style presets can change the look of your world without changing who your characters are.
